Here's the plot: "2013 USA Directed by Ken Jacobs With technical assistance by Nisi Jacobs Part two of four Joysbegan on the corner of Broadway and Spring but it was the next night waiting on Bleecker that it was understood a movie of sorts was underway depicting a general waiting for the bus rather than one specific evening Since acquiring a small 3D camera I dawdle everywhere but prolonged buswaits allow for a continuity of images thus a movie Computerediting with Nisi Jacobs allowed further investigation this time into digital 3D itself In 3D 40 min The Museum of Modern Art" .
